Athletics: Tsegay and Sawyers announced for the Nikaïa meeting

Less than a month before the return of the Nikaïa meeting (Saturday, June 17), the organizers have announced the presence of world champion Gudaf Tsegay and European champion Jazmin Sawyers.

The Nikaïa meeting in Nice is starting to attract some big names. As athletes are finalizing their schedules for the upcoming outdoor season, two internationally renowned athletes have already marked the event in the French Riviera on their calendars. It is, therefore, with an eye on their preparation for the World Championships, which will be held from August 19 to 27, 2023, in Budapest, that Gudaf Tsegay and Jazmin Sawyers will be present in Nice on June 17.

This year’s indoor European champion in long jump, Jazmin Sawyers, expressed her eagerness “to participate in this year’s Nikaïa edition. It has been years since I had the opportunity to jump in front of the French public, and I can’t wait to give my best in front of such elite athletes and in a venue like the Charles Ehrmann Stadium, which holds historic significance for our sport”.

Gudaf Tsegay as a Guest Star

But the one who will undoubtedly turn heads is the reigning world champion in the 5,000M, Gudaf Tsegay. The Ethiopian athlete set remarkable records last year and is determined to improve in order to clinch Olympic gold next year. It’s the only title missing from her record at just 26 years old. A true star in middle-distance events, she will compete in a specially designed 10,000M race.

As a reminder, the Nikaïa Meeting will take place on June 17 at the Charles Ehrmann Stadium starting at 7 PM (scheduled to end at 10 PM).
